What Is the Bomas International Convention Centre?
The Bomas International Convention Centre is a proposed state-of-the-art conference and exhibition complex located in Nairobi, Kenya. Strategically situated near Jomo Kenyatta International Airport (JKIA) and Wilson Airport, the BICC is designed to make Kenya a serious contender in the global MICE (Meetings, Incentives, Conferences, and Exhibitions) industry — a sector that contributes hundreds of billions of dollars to economies worldwide each year.
Planned Features of the BICC
- Large-scale convention and exhibition halls capable of hosting thousands of delegates simultaneously
- Flexible meeting and breakout conference facilities for workshops, seminars, and bilateral sessions
- Business networking and co-working spaces designed for modern delegates
- Integrated hospitality and accommodation support infrastructure
- Sustainable, environmentally conscious architecture aligned with global green building standards
- Seamless transport connectivity to Nairobi’s major airports and the CBD

A Catalyst for Kenya’s Business Tourism Economy
Business travelers consistently outspend leisure tourists. They book premium accommodation, use ground transportation more frequently, dine at higher-end establishments, and — critically — they bring entire delegations with them. A single international conference can bring hundreds or thousands of high-value visitors to a city in a single week.
The Bomas International Convention Centre is expected to generate increased demand across Kenya’s full tourism and hospitality ecosystem:
- International flights into Nairobi’s airports
- Hotel accommodation from budget delegate packages to five-star executive suites
- Airport transfers and ground transport logistics
- Corporate travel management and event coordination services
- Delegate experiences and team-building programs
- Pre- and post-conference leisure tourism across Kenya’s world-famous destinations
